Josh Hoover Growing Into Cignetti's System
Indiana quarterback Josh Hoover is entering the season as the unquestioned starter after three straight seasons of starting at TCU. Hand-picked by national championship-winning coach Curt Cignetti to succeed Fernando Mendoza, the expectations are through the roof this season for Hoover. On Hoover, Cignetti stated: "osh Hoover has won a lot of football games, thrown for a lot of yards, lot of touchdown passes. He has an innate ability to play the position of quarterback. He's kind of a natural passer, very accurate, processes very quickly. The things we'll ask him to do are different than the things TCU asked him to do. We're not going to put the ball in his hands and say go out, win the game, outscore people. We're going to give him a running game, defense and special teams." Cignetti is very happy with the way that Hoover has progressed in his system throughout the summer, and it sounds like the veteran is the perfect fit to keep the Hoosiers' momentum rolling coming off of the national title.
